LOMBO MORENO, Carlos Ernesto. Early Goal Directed Therapy Strategy for Sepsis Management. Univ. Med. [online]. 2021, vol.62, n.3, pp.77-86. Epub June 30, 2021. ISSN 0041-9095. https://doi.org/10.11144/javeriana.umed62-3.ertg.
Sepsis and septic shock are associated with high morbidity and mortality outcomes. Therefore, early identification and a proper intervention provide better outcomes. The method to develop the identification and intervention is usually released in guidelines. The Early Goal Directed Therapy (EGDT), which is operative based on River’s study in the beginning of this century stands out. Although there have been subsequent studies which disapprove this study, the EGDT concept persists in the Surviving Sepsis guidelines and in the current clinical practice. As the medical knowledge evolve, static measures have been abandoned and other measures as early fluid an antibiotic administration, lactate clearance and a proper and continuous patient assessment has been stablished.
